What “open enrollment” truthfully means
There are quite a few Medicare enrollment windows, every single with a specific aim. People more often than not mix them up, which ends up in complications. The two that trigger the such a lot confusion are the fall Annual Enrollment Period and the early-yr Medicare Advantage Open Enrollment Period.
- Annual Enrollment Period, more often than not which is called AEP, runs every single 12 months from October 15 simply by December 7. During this time, any individual with Medicare can review and transfer Medicare Advantage plans, be a part of or drop a prescription drug plan, or return to Original Medicare without or with a stand-by myself Part D plan. Changes take end result on January 1. Medicare Advantage Open Enrollment Period, MA OEP, runs from January 1 by March 31. It is only for laborers already enrolled in a Medicare Advantage plan. You can transfer to a specific Medicare Advantage plan or stream from Medicare Advantage again to Original Medicare and a Part D plan. You is not going to be a part of a Medicare Advantage plan if you are on Original Medicare at some stage in this window.
Other home windows remember too. The Initial Enrollment Period is a seven-month span that starts off three months prior to your sixty fifth birthday month and ends three months after. For those who behind schedule Part B given that they had corporation coverage, there are Special Enrollment Periods. If you missed Part B solely Medicare Open Enrollment and do not qualify for a one of a kind window, the General Enrollment Period runs January as a result of March. Original Medicare, Medicare Advantage, and how a complement fits
Open enrollment conversations mostly birth with a usual fork in the street: Original Medicare plus elective add-ons, or all-in-one Medicare Advantage. The course that matches you depends for your medical doctors, your funds, your future health background, and your tolerance for documents.
Original Medicare is Part A for medical institution care and Part B for outpatient and healthcare professional facilities. On its very own, Original Medicare has no cap to your share of expenses. Many human beings add a Medicare Supplement, additionally called Medigap, and a stand-on my own Part D prescription drug plan. With a strong complement, your out-of-pocket prices for medical capabilities may well be very predictable. The industry-off is a monthly top rate for the supplement and the want to hold a separate drug plan. You can see any supplier nationwide who takes Medicare. For people who break up time among Florida and every other country, or who would like large access for uniqueness care, this pliability is additionally decisive.
Medicare Advantage, also often known as Part C, bundles Parts A and B and as a rule Part D into one plan offered by means of a confidential Medicare Insurance Company. These plans set copays and out-of-pocket maximums. They most likely consist of extras like restricted dental, imaginative and prescient, listening to, fitness memberships, and frequently transportation. In Cape Coral, many Medicare Advantage plans are HMOs, with some PPO solutions. The premium will likely be very low, even 0, due to the fact the plan receives a cost from Medicare to handle your care. The commerce-offs embody managing networks, acquiring referrals in some plans, and paying copays whilst you use functions. If your medical doctors are in-community and also you comprehend predictable copays, Medicare Advantage will also be an competent setup.
A Medicare Supplement is not very used with a Medicare Advantage plan. You prefer one path or the opposite. The timing for Medicare Supplement enrollment is different from AEP. The gold standard time to get a supplement is all through your one-time Medigap open enrollment window, which starts off the month you might be both 65 or older and enrolled in Part B, and lasts six months. During that window you quite often is not going to be denied policy or charged more by way of fitness circumstances. Outside of that, shopping or switching supplement plans may possibly require underwriting in Florida, though nation-particular rights regularly give chances. Because Florida’s ideas can replace, determine with a neighborhood Medicare Insurance Agency or SHINE prior to Medicare Insurance you think one thing is very unlikely.
Prescription insurance plan deserves its very own focus
In Lee County, I see many persons base their finished plan possibility on their docs and hospitals, then get shocked through prescription fees in January. Formularies can transfer tablets to larger tiers, require past authorization, or replace widespread pharmacies year to 12 months. A plan that was once supreme for your medicines in 2024 may cost tons of more in 2025 for the equal medicinal drugs.
If you're taking brand-identify drugs, run a charge assessment throughout not less than three Medicare Insurance Plans which might be amazing in Cape Coral. Pay concentration to:
- Whether your medications are at the formulary, and on which tier. If previous authorization, step medication, or variety limits apply. Preferred pharmacies around Cape Coral, such as vast chains, independents, and mail order. The plan’s medical care of the protection hole, noticeably for larger-check healing procedures.
I matter a man in northwest Cape Coral who paid virtually nothing for his prescriptions three hundred and sixty five days and almost $900 a higher. Nothing approximately his health and wellbeing transformed. His plan shifted two of his generics to a non-favorite tier and removed his pharmacy from the popular community. We corrected it for the duration of AEP, however it turned into a rough surprise. Ten minutes spent checking the plan’s drug search instrument saves check and headaches.

Avoiding the so much high priced mistakes
I even have noticed 3 blunders repeat basically, and they are all fixable with about a more exams.
The first is assuming remaining yr’s community equals next year’s community. Contracts shift. Always re-be sure your key suppliers in the time of AEP. If a plan’s listing indicates your doctor however the place of business says they're leaving, have confidence the place of job and ask for the effective date. Even a one-month hole can create marvel costs.
The 2d is lacking Part D utterly. People who sense in shape every so often skip a drug plan on Original Medicare. If you pass 63 or greater days devoid of creditable prescription coverage, that you would be able to face a lifetime penalty whenever you do register. The penalty is inconspicuous per 30 days, however it does no longer depart. A low-premium Part D plan can keep you blanketed even in case you take no medicines.
The third is mixing up Medigap and Medicare Advantage policies. You won't be able to use a Medicare Supplement with a Medicare Advantage plan. And in case you leave Original Medicare with a complement to try out a Medicare Advantage plan, returning to a supplement later may well require clinical underwriting in Florida unless you could have a particular appropriate is known as a tribulation appropriate or yet one more safeguard. Talk this by using formerly you switch.
How to factor in prices, with genuine numbers
Costs are more than the top class. In Cape Coral, I sometimes sketch two situations on a notepad.
Scenario one: Original Medicare with a customary mid-tier Medicare Supplement and a cheap Part D plan. Say the supplement is around $a hundred and fifty to $220 per month at age 70, and the Part D plan is $10 to $40 relying on medicines. You pay these premiums per month, plus small or no quotes while you operate many Part A and B features, relying at the supplement letter. If you want an outpatient surgery, your out-of-pocket is minimum other than the drug copays for the anesthetic or publish-op prescriptions. If you commute most of the time, nothing differences once you exit of kingdom.
Scenario two: A zero-top class HMO Medicare Advantage plan. No per 30 days top rate past Part B. Office stopover at copays range possibly $0 to $50 depending on widespread care or experts. Outpatient surgical operation could be a flat copay or coinsurance. The optimum out-of-pocket for in-community Part A and B functions maybe $three,500 to $7,500 for the yr. If you keep healthy, costs will also be very low. In a 12 months with a hospitalization or a couple of strategies, you might want to system the max. If your well-liked expert is out of network, you both swap docs or swap plans.
Neither situation is inherently larger. One values predictability and freedom to pick carriers nationwide. The different can minimize premiums and kit extras like dental and fitness advantages, with the self-discipline of a community and copays. Your decision must always healthy the way you stay, no longer most effective what you pay in January.

If you're turning 65 inside the heart of all this
Open enrollment within the fall regularly overlaps with your Initial Enrollment Period. The preliminary window takes priority. If your sixty fifth birthday is in December, your seven-month IEP runs from September via March. Your judgements then are approximately activating Part A and Part B, opting for a Medicare Supplement or a Medicare Advantage plan, and deciding on a Part D plan if essential. You may additionally put off Part B with no penalty you probably have qualifying business enterprise policy as a result of lively paintings. Retiree protection isn't very almost like active policy cover. If your drawback entails service provider plans, get readability from your HR division and ensure with Medicare.
People usually ask whether to sign up for Part A if they are nevertheless contributing to a Health Savings Account. Part A enrollment can retroactively switch on up to 6 months and disqualify HSA contributions for those months. If you are nonetheless working and desire to retailer contributing to an HSA, converse with a educated Medical Insurance Agent or a tax advisor before you follow.
